Short description
Technical advances and the increasing use of unmanned aircraft systems (UAS) are opening up new possibilities for monitoring propagation episodes or in the event of accidents. In contrast to radiosondes, these techniques can detect not only vertical but also horizontal fields of meteorological quantities and air admixtures. The standard deals with various measurement techniques which are the subject of the series of standards VDI 3786 and can be used in unmanned aerial vehicles. In addition, techniques are described which are specifically used on aircraft. Especially the particular characteristics of the measuring instrument carriers and the resulting necessary adjustments of the sensor technology are taken into account. The determination of horizontal fields and vertical structures by different flight patterns and the possibilities of interpretation in relation to the series of standards VDI 3783 and VDI 3787 as well as the surface properties are particularly worked out.
